UD, YWCA Dayton working together to make Brown Street safer

Monday, August 29, 2022

Staff at bars, restaurants and clubs operating near University of Dayton are getting empowered to stand up against sexual harassment and assault by learning innovative bystander intervention strategies. University of Dayton Student Government Association and UD Public Safety have been working with YWCA Dayton to bring the nonprofit’s Gem City Safe Bars intervention program to… Continue Reading UD, YWCA Dayton working together to make Brown Street safer

Celebrating 20 years of dedication

Wednesday, August 17, 2022

YWCA Dayton is celebrating Lynette Kight, who has marked 20 years of service with the nonprofit. Kight, a client support coordinator, can be found working at the front desk of YWCA Dayton’s Central Building. She never knows what the day will bring, from walk-in clients, to donations drop offs, to resident requests, and more.  It… Continue Reading Celebrating 20 years of dedication
